School Exclusions Hub

Our School Exclusions Hub offers free information and resources for professionals and community organisations supporting children and their families to challenge school exclusions.

Published 21 July 2023
6,495

children were permanently excluded from school in 2021/22

The hub is the UK’s largest online resource covering every aspect of school exclusions.

Dedicated to the protection and promotion of children’s rights

Coram International works with governments, UN bodies, IGOs and NGOs around the world to protect and promote children and young people’s human rights.

Published 21 March 2023
94

countries worked in

We provide professional support to local, national and international governments and organisations to uphold children’s rights.

Championing children's rights

We provide free legal information, advice and representation to children and young people, families, carers and professionals. Our consultancy work helps uphold children’s rights internationally. We combine our frontline work and our specialist knowledge to ensure children’s rights are embedded in law, policy and practice.

Published 15 February 2023
15,609

People received legal advice via email/phone in 2021/2022

Our Child Law Advice Service provides free legal information and advice on family and education law.
